1

多くの単一共変量ロジスティック回帰を取得する方法があるかどうか疑問に思っています。値が欠落しているため、すべての変数に対してそれを実行したいと考えています。複数のロジスティック回帰を実行したかったのですが、欠損値が多すぎます。DB の各変数のロジスティック回帰を計算したくありません。自動化する方法はありますか?

どうもありがとうございました!

4

1 に答える 1

2

SPSS 構文を使用してコーディングできます。

例えば:

LOGISTIC REGRESSION VARIABLES F2B16C -- Dependent variable


  /METHOD=BSTEP -- Backwards step - all variables in then see what could be backed out

  XRACE BYSES2 BYTXMSTD F1RGPP2 F1STEXP XHiMath  -- Independent variables

  /contrast (xrace)=indicator(6)  -- creates the dummy variables with #6 as the base case

  /contrast (F1Rgpp2)=indicator(6)

  /contrast (f1stexp)=indicator(6)

  /contrast (XHiMath)=indicator(5)

  /PRINT=GOODFIT CORR ITER(1) 

  /CRITERIA=PIN(0.05) POUT(0.10) ITERATE(20) CUT(0.5).`

これを行う場合、必要に応じて欠損値のあるレコードを保持するように指示することもできます。/MISSING=INCLUDE を追加

欠落した値を含めることの意味について、誰かが適切な説明を知っている場合は、ぜひ聞きたいです。

于 2011-02-26T20:28:40.470 に答える